1. 性能监控指标:主要包括帧率、加载时间、缓冲次数等。帧率反映视频播放的流畅度,高帧率意味着更流畅的画面;加载时间指视频从开始加载到可以播放的时间,加载时间越短,用户等待时间越少;缓冲次数过多会影响观看体验,需尽量减少。
2. 监控工具与方法:可利用Chrome开发者工具中的“Performance”面板和“Network”面板进行监控。在“Performance”面板中,通过录制视频播放过程,分析帧率、CPU使用率等性能指标;在“Network”面板中,查看视频资源的加载情况,包括加载时间、数据传输量等,以评估加载性能。
3. 插件对性能的影响:不同的视频播放插件可能对性能产生不同影响。一些插件可能会增加额外的处理逻辑或资源占用,导致帧率下降、加载时间延长等问题。需要对插件进行测试和评估,选择对性能影响较小的插件。
4. 优化策略:根据监控结果,采取相应的优化措施。如优化视频编码格式、调整缓存设置、减少不必要的插件等,以提高视频播放性能。同时,定期进行性能监控,及时发现和解决潜在问题,确保视频播放的流畅性和稳定性。